19589 - PS Telematik Projekt: Embedded Sensor Web

Similar documents
DEGREE PROGRAMME IN INFORMATION TECHNOLOGY

Marko Hännikäinen Tampere University of Technology IoT week CLOUD-BASED SERVICE PLATFORM FOR WIRELESS SENSOR NETWORKS

San José State University College of Engineering/Computer Engineering Department CMPE 206, Computer Network Design, Section 1, Fall 2015

Selection Criteria for ZigBee Development Kits

A Transport Protocol for Multimedia Wireless Sensor Networks

COMP252: Systems Administration and Networking Online SYLLABUS COURSE DESCRIPTION OBJECTIVES

In summer semester and in winter semester

New York City College of Technology Computer Systems Technology Department

Embedded Internet and the Internet of Things WS 12/13

Introduction to Programming

UG103.8 APPLICATION DEVELOPMENT FUNDAMENTALS: TOOLS

IT 101 Introduction to Information Technology

CS 5480 Computer Networks

Computer and Network Security

City of Dublin Education & Training Board. Programme Module for. Mobile Technologies. leading to. Level 6 FETAC. Mobile Technologies 6N0734

Computer Network & ICT Support Technician

IC 1101 Basic Electronic Practice for Electronics and Information Engineering

The Masters of Science in Information Systems & Technology

REMOTE TEMPERATURE AND HUMIDITY MONITORING SYSTEM USING WIRELESS SENSOR NETWORKS

Graduation Project Ideas Proposed By Faculty Members Department of Communication and Networks

Class and Office Hours. Course Requirements. Concepts to Learn. CMPUT 499: Introduction

University of Central Florida Department of Electrical Engineering & Computer Science EEL 4914C Spring Senior Design I

Protocols and Architectures for Wireless Sensor Netwoks. by Holger Karl and Andreas Willig

GRA 1751 Web Design One (Graphic Interface Design One) Course handout revised by Sam Grant 01 /06

CSET 4750 Computer Networks and Data Communications (4 semester credit hours) CSET Required IT Required

MeshBee Open Source ZigBee RF Module CookBook

How To Get A Computer Science Degree

Smart Integration of Wireless Temperature Monitoring System with Building Automation System

CSci 4211: Data Communications and Computer Networks. Time: Tuesday and Thursday 8:15 to 9:30 am Location: Phyics 170 Spring 2015, 3 Credits

Syllabus for EE 459Lx Spring 2016

Computer Science 3CN3 Computer Networks and Security. Software Engineering 4C03 Computer Networks and Computer Security. Winter 2008 Course Outline

How To Prepare And Manage A Project

PrioVR Production Plan:

BROWSER-BASED HOME MONITOR USING ZIGBEE SENSORS

Sensor Devices and Sensor Network Applications for the Smart Grid/Smart Cities. Dr. William Kao

Master of Science (Electrical Engineering) MS(EE)

DESIGN AND IMPLEMENTATION OF ONLINE PATIENT MONITORING SYSTEM

How to design and implement firmware for embedded systems

CIS490 Design in Software Engineering. Course Syllabus for the Virtual Class

Intel Do-It-Yourself Challenge Lab 2: Intel Galileo s Linux side Nicolas Vailliet

Computer Science Graduate Degree Requirements

Assessment for Master s Degree Program Fall Spring 2011 Computer Science Dept. Texas A&M University - Commerce

Question Shall the Tender include installation of the central server application on a redundant server?

Network security and privacy

Summer 2015 Human Resource Administration Syllabus

TTM4128: Network and Service Management - TTM4128: Network and Service Management - Part A.1 : Course Overview and Introduction.

Course Title: ITAP 2431: Network Management. Semester Credit Hours: 4 (3,1)

Summer projects for Dept. of IT students in the summer 2015

Network connectivity controllers

PRTG Training Standard, Pro & Expert

ESUMS HIGH SCHOOL. Computer Network & Engineering (CNE) Syllabus

A UNIVERSAL MACHINE FOR THE INDUSTRIAL INTERNET OF THINGS. MultiConnect Conduit

CS 261 C and Assembly Language Programming. Course Syllabus

32nd Infection Prevention & Control Nurses College Conference. Designing Healthcare Facilities; managing the requirements of healthcare professionals.

HomeReACT a Tool for Real-time Indoor Environmental Monitoring

QSG105 GETTING STARTED WITH SILICON LABS WIRELESS NETWORKING SOFTWARE

6LoWPAN Technical Overview

Masters in Information Technology

CONFIGURATION MANAGEMENT PLAN

Graduate Degree Requirements

LEARNING SOLUTIONS website milner.com/learning phone

ICT Infrastructure & Network Management

Technology and Online Computer Access Requirements: Lake-Sumter State College Course Syllabus

Raghavendra Reddy D 1, G Kumara Swamy 2

in Health Care and Sensor Networks

Computer and Information Sciences

Service and Resource Discovery in Smart Spaces Composed of Low Capacity Devices

Family and Consumer Science Department Syllabus

Monitoring Software using Sun Spots. Corey Andalora February 19, 2008

Syllabus CIS 3630: Management Information Systems Spring 2009

REPUBLIC OF TURKEY BEYKENT UNIVERSITY ACADEMIC REGULATIONS FOR UNDERGRADUATE LEVEL OF STUDY

CMPSCI 453 Computer Networking. Professor V. Arun Department of Computer Science University of Massachusetts Amherst

WIRELESS SENSOR NETWORK INTEGRATING WITH CLOUD COMPUTING FOR PATIENT MONITORING

PROGRAMME SPECIFICATION UNDERGRADUATE PROGRAMMES. Programme BEng Computer Systems Engineering/BEng Computer Systems Engineering with Placement

Information Systems and Technology in Healthcare

obems - open source Building energy Management System T4 Sustainability Ltd

SYLLABUS CIS 3660: OBJECT-ORIENTED SYSTEM ANALYSIS AND DESIGN SPRING 2010

Combined Bachelor s/master s Degree Program Sponsored by the Graduate School and the Honors Program

Hybrid Software Architecture Design Pattern Model

A Secure Intrusion detection system against DDOS attack in Wireless Mobile Ad-hoc Network Abstract

Cisco Discovery 1: Networking for Home and Small Business (ITCC 1310)

Transcription:

Summer Term 2008 19589 - PS Telematik Projekt: Embedded Sensor Web Achim Liers Bastian Blywis Marko Hutta

Organization Prerequisites: Bachelor or Vordiplom Supervised lab course Task handed to group of 9 students Projektseminar : Praktikums- oder Seminarschein (decide early!) ECTS-credits: 10 Hardware supplied for whole semester to all attendees 2

Course Requirements No exam Attend lab hours Presentation Hand in your work before deadline containing: - Commented/documented source code ( doxygen style ) - Documentation describing your task and the solution - If your task could not be solved successfully describe the problems and what is missing! - Presentation slides Minimum of 150 work hours (150h/14weeks 10.7h/week) Seminarschein: Focus on theoretical background 3

Required skills and knowledge Experience with the C programming language Experience with the Java programming language Courses: Computer Architecture, Telematics, Mobile Communications Doxygen Subversion Teamwork, teamwork, teamwork!!! 4

Schedule 09.04.2008: - First Meeting - Introduction, Requirements - Handout of customer requirement specification - Preliminary team forming 16.04.2008: - Introduction to ScatterWeb² firmware (first steps) - Final team forming 23.04.2008-16.07.2008: - Supervised lab hours, team meetings, milestone presentations 14.07.2008: - Hand in your presentation slides (PDF only!) 16.07.2008: - Final Event: Talk + Demo 23.07.2008: - Hand in your work (deadline is 24:00), return hardware 5

Topic (abstract) Wireless Sensor Network (WSN) - spatially distributed autonomous devices - equipped with sensors - cooperative monitoring and computation - origin: military - embedded systems - wireless ad-hoc network - network size: up to 10.000 nodes 6

Topic (specific) Home Automation Wireless Sensor Network - nodes with temperature and humidity sensor - GPIO pins to connect actuators or external sensors - data aggregation - solution encompassing all ISO/OSI layers - web based management + configuration - contour map 7

Schein requirements Developed solution has to work Documentation must be available (about 40-50 pages per team) Presentation of all team members Meet deadlines Optional: Non-mandatory features (improve grade!) Attend Wednesdays meetings (at least 85%) - inform team members and advisors on absence - hand in attest/doctor's note - make up time at home 8

What is provided? Rudimentary operation system Several code packages Open source compiler toolchain (MSPGCC) Sensor nodes, required cables, flash interface Project description/customer requirement specification 9

Milestones 07.05.08: - Task assignment to team members - General approach to solve the problem - Interface definitions, selected routing protocols, management application prototype 11.06.08: - Mid-term presentation 02.07.08: - Preview of final event - Overview: What's finished, what's missing? 16.07.08: - Final Event: Talk + Demo 10

Task till next week (Re-) Read course requirements Read customer requirement specification Get familiar with C, Java, Doxygen, Subversion, LaTex,... Get clear picture of affection Keep in contact with (preliminary) team Optional: Start with background research of your task 11

Questions? THE END Questions? 12